School Description
School Summary and Highlights
- Enrolls 753 middle and high school students from grades 7-9
- Ranks 45th out of 456 middle schools in WA.
School Operational Details
- Title I Eligible
School District Details
- Northshore School District
- Per-Pupil Spending: $8,763
- Graduation Rate: 89.5%
- Dropout Rate: 2.6%
- Students Per Teacher: 21.7
- Enrolled Students: 19,707
Faculty Details and Student Enrollment
Students and Faculty
- Total Students Enrolled: 753
- Total Full Time "Equivalent" Teachers: 32.7
- Average Student-To-Teacher Ratio: 23.0
Students Gender Breakdown
- Males: 359 (47.7%)
- Females: 368 (48.9%)
Free Lunch Student Eligibility Breakdown
- Eligible for Reduced Lunch: 48 (6.4%)
- Eligible for Free Lunch: 103 (13.7%)
- Eligible for Either Reduced or Free Lunch: 151 (20.1%)
Student Enrollment Distribution by Race / Ethnicity

| Number | Percent | |
|---|---|---|
| American Indian | 7 | 0.9% |
| Black | 20 | 2.7% |
| Asian | 69 | 9.2% |
| Hispanic | 74 | 9.8% |
| White | 557 | 74.0% |
Number of Students Per Grade

| Number | Percent | |
|---|---|---|
| 7th Grade | 241 | 32.0% |
| 8th Grade | 258 | 34.3% |
| 9th Grade | 254 | 33.7% |
Source: WA Department of Education, Source: NCES 2009-2010
